FORCE BLUE

In 2023, we united with FORCE BLUE as the first company to fund their Quick Reaction Force, a team to help Florida's marine science community and environmental agencies respond quickly to marine environmental emergencies.

FORCE BLUE is an organization that retrains and redeploys Special Operations military veterans and military combat divers to work alongside scientists, environmental agencies and leaders on marine conservation missions.

Sustainable Fisheries Partnership

Since 2011, we've provided more than $700,000 to the Sustainable Fisheries Partnership (SFP) to support fishery improvement projects and promote sustainable seafood practices. Our recent efforts with SFP have focused on reducing bycatch and entanglement of non-target, endangered and threatened species. Unintended catch, or bycatch, is when fisheries accidentally catch non-target wildlife like whales, sea turtles, sharks, dolphins and seabirds.
